As of April 22, 2025, the average annual salary for a Sales Coach/Trainer II in the United Kingdom is £39,630, with an hourly rate of £19, according to Salary.com Global Salary IQ data. The average salary ranges from £36,020 to £48,760, influenced by factors like location, education, experience, and more.

How Much Do Sales Coach/Trainer IIs Earn at Different Levels in 2025?

A Sales Coach/Trainer II's salary varies significantly based on experience level. Entry typically earn £36,990 - £39,091, while Intermediate make £37,151 - £39,253, Senior earn £38,283 - £41,265, Specialist earn £39,630 - £44,808, Expert can reach £40,993 - £46,307 or more, depending on the company and location.

What are the Highest Paying Cities in the United Kingdom for Sales Coach/Trainer II?

The top 3 highest-paying cities in the United Kingdom for Sales Coach/Trainer II are London, Brighton and Hove, and Manchester. In London, the average salary is £42,800 per year, while Brighton and Hove offers £39,924, and Manchester pays around £37,987 annually.

Which Job Pays More: Sales Manager II or Sales Coach/Trainer II?

As of April 22, 2025 , a Sales Manager II makes more than a Sales Coach/Trainer II. A Sales Manager II earns an average annual salary of £83,355. And a Sales Coach/Trainer II earns an average annual salary of £39,630.
